What is the main function of a latch?

Explanation:
The primary function of a latch is to store data as long as power is supplied. Latches are basic memory devices that retain their output state until they are triggered to change. This makes them essential in digital circuits, as they enable the storage of binary information, allowing systems to remember the state of a signal or a bit of data even when there are no active input signals. The behavior of latches is fundamental to memory design in digital electronics, serving roles in a variety of applications such as data storage, state retention in sequential logic, and synchronizing signal changes. Unlike other components such as amplifiers or timers, which perform different functions, the latch's intrinsic ability to hold onto data makes it a crucial building block in both memory and logic circuits.
